文摘Species in Talaromyces section Trachyspermi are isolated from a wide range of substrates,including soil,house dust,leaf,wood and fruit from temperate region to tropical areas.During a survey of fungal diversity in Zoige wetlands,three isolates with biverticillate adpressed penicilli and spheroidal conidia belonging to Talaromyces are isolated from peat soil.Phylogenetic analyses based on a combined ITS,BenA,CaM and RPB2 sequence data suggests they represent a novel taxon in Talaromyces section Trachyspermi,namely Talaromyces peaticola.In spite of T.peaticola has a close affinity to T.diversus in phylogeny,it is readily distinguished from the later,resulted from growing slowly on CREA at 25℃,exudating small clear droplets on MEA,and producing smaller conidia than that of T.diversus.

文摘A hyperparasitic fungus was found on uredinia of Coleosporium plumeria on leaves of Plumeria rubra in Thailand.The hyperparasite was identified as Ramularia coleosporii following an examination of its morphological characters and a phylogenetic analysis by using ITS sequence data.This is the first record of R.coleosporii on C.plumeriae in Thailand.Ramularia coleosporii has the potential for biocontrol management strategies of the rust.
